Introduction of the Isononanoic Acid Market
Isononanoic acid is a saturated carboxylic acid with a branched chain that is mostly utilized in the manufacturing of esters for coatings, lubricants, and cosmetics. It is useful in a variety of industrial and personal care applications due to its low volatility and thermal stability, which improve product performance and longevity. Growing demand from the lubricant, cosmetics, and personal care sectors is driving the isononanoic acid market because of its exceptional stability and low volatility. Additionally, its application in high-performance lubricants and coatings has been stimulated by increased industrialization and automobile manufacturing. The growing consumer preference for skin-friendly and long-lasting cosmetic formulas also contributes to market expansion. Furthermore, isononanoic acid is increasingly being used in a variety of applications across the globe, partly due to technological developments and a move toward high-performance, sustainable chemicals.

Impact of Trump Tariffs on the Isononanoic Acid Market
The global market for isononanoic acid was greatly impacted by the tariffs imposed under the Trump administration, and the Trump administration increased duties on imports, particularly from China. Tariffs of up to 25% were applied to catalysts and petrochemical derivatives, two important raw materials and intermediary compounds used in the synthesis of isononanoic acid. Supply chains were upset by these higher expenses, and manufacturers were compelled to change their pricing policies, which decreased their ability to compete in international markets.
Furthermore, due to a lack of funding to cover growing expenses, small and medium-sized businesses were most affected, which resulted in narrower profit margins and hindered innovation. On the other hand, although they were not completely immune to the market instability, larger enterprises with diverse sourcing networks were better positioned to lessen the effects.
Additionally, the trade uncertainties brought forth by the tariffs forced businesses to look for domestic substitutes or build new supplier relationships outside of tariffed areas. These modifications resulted in increased operating expenses, regulatory hold-ups, and logistical difficulties. Because of this, end-user sectors that depend on isononanoic acid for formulation, like personal care, lubricants, and coatings, experienced delays in product introductions and higher production costs.?
